Output 111a72973dd24dc22dba63154cdb851fa023a04323e0b45e105d54f7a25afaf1:0

value
38724863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a52290bf509451dbb2b6b357e9e270af52527e4 OP_EQUAL
address
32db74aQD241SrKAFY74SSH8t2JMM6ffJH
transaction
111a72973dd24dc22dba63154cdb851fa023a04323e0b45e105d54f7a25afaf1
confirmations
336622
spent
true